Distance between Devils Lake and Amecameca
Distance from Devils Lake, ND to Amecameca is 2003 miles / 3223 kilometers.
Map showing the distance from Devils Lake to Amecameca
![]() |
Air distance: | miles km |
Devils Lake, ND
City: | Devils Lake, ND |
Country: | United States |
Amecameca
City: | Amecameca |
Country: | Mexico |
Time difference between Devils Lake and Amecameca
There is no time difference between Devils Lake and Amecameca. Current local time in Devils Lake and Amecameca is 21:57 CST (2025-03-04)